When it comes to getting into shape, it’s not enough that you focus on exercising and removing toxins from your body. It’s just as important to focus on what you put in your body. “Nutrition is the basis for a healthy lifestyle,” says Olga Barreal, Los Cab’s in-house nutritionist. “I’d say it’s 80 percent nutrition and 20 percent exercise.

If you don’t have proper nutrition, even if you exercise a lot you’re not going to get the results you expect.” However, Barreal cautions that one diet is not right for everyone. Proper nutrition depends on a person’s age, activity level, health, weight, and personal goals. Your workout regimen plays a role.
